I have a LG 42 LW65oo 3D TV which has HDMI/DVI IN 1 (ARC) and another three HDMI/DVI IN Ports(2,3 & 4). I also have a Sony 3D Blu-ray System BDV E880. This has a HDMI OUT ARC and two HDMI IN (1 & 2). I also want to connect this system to Tata Sky DTH cable connection. Tata Sky has got one HDMI port, one SPDIF Optical port and Audio OUT ( L & R ) and Video OUT connectors. The LG TV also has a Optical Digital Audio OUT port and Sony BDV E880 has a Digital Optical IN. Kindly suggest me the Best connection scheme for Best Audio-Video.

You have posted this in the wrong section as this isn't related to a soundbar but your connections seem to be pretty straightforward. It seems like you just have a TV, a BD player/HT system, and a cable box. If so, connect the cable box to one of the HDMI inputs on the Sony system and connect the HDMI OUT from the Sony system to the TV (via HDMI). You shouldn't need any optical connections.
